paper trade
English
Noun
the
paper
trade
The
business
of
buying
and
selling
paper
.
(
UK
,
slang
,
obsolete
)
The sale of printed
song
lyrics
by
street
peddlers
.
See also
paperworker
pinner-up
running stationer
Anagrams
trade paper
,
tarpapered